Filipinos celebrate their graduation by attending a commencement ceremony, taking photos with family and friends, receiving gifts or money from loved ones, and having a celebratory meal or party. Many also follow traditions like the wearing of the sablay or traditional attire, throwing caps in the air, and displaying graduation memorabilia at home.
